摘要
We experimentally demonstrate the operation of a fully integrated optoelectronic circuit with optical input and output consisting of a p-i-n photodetector and load resistor, a depletion mode GaAs-AlxGa1-xAs heterostructure field effect transistor (HFET) and self-biased HFET load, together with an output GaAs-AlxGa1-xAs multiple quantum-well optical modulator. All elements have been monolithically integrated within a 50 x 50-mu-m area. A low optical power input causes a modulation of a higher power output, demonstrating optical signal amplification.
